Excluir buckets de armazenamento de objetos do Lightsail - Amazon Lightsail

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Excluir buckets de armazenamento de objetos do Lightsail

Exclua seu bucket no serviço de armazenamento de objetos Amazon Lightsail se você não o estiver mais usando. Quando você exclui seu bucket, todos os objetos no bucket, incluindo versões armazenadas de objetos e chaves de acesso, são excluídos permanentemente.

Para obter mais informações sobre buckets, consulte Armazenamento de objetos.

Forçar a exclusão de um bucket

Os buckets que têm uma das seguintes condições não podem ser excluídos a menos que você confirme a exclusão:

  • O bucket é a origem de uma distribuição.

  • O bucket tem instâncias anexadas a ele.

  • O bucket tem objetos.

  • O bucket tem chaves de acesso.

Você deve confirmar a exclusão para garantir que você não interrompa um fluxo de trabalho atual que dependa do bucket. Por exemplo, um WordPress site que armazena mídia no bucket ou uma distribuição que está armazenando em cache e servindo objetos em seu bucket.

Para confirmar a exclusão de um bucket que tenha uma das condições anteriores, você deve forçar a exclusão do bucket. Antes de excluir o bucket, o serviço Lightsail pergunta quais dessas condições existem nele. Se você usa o console Lightsail para excluir seu bucket, você tem a opção de forçar a exclusão. Se você usar o AWS CLI, deverá especificar o --force-delete sinalizador ao fazer uma delete-bucket solicitação. Esses dois procedimentos são abordados nas seções Excluir seu bucket usando o console Lightsail e Excluir seu bucket usando AWS CLI as seções deste guia.

Exclua seu bucket usando o console Lightsail

Conclua o procedimento a seguir para excluir seu bucket usando o console do Lightsail.

  1. Faça login no console do Lightsail.

  2. Na página inicial do Lightsail, escolha a guia Armazenamento.

  3. Escolha o nome do bucket a ser excluído.

  4. Escolha o ícone de reticências (⋮) no menu de abas e escolha Excluir.

  5. Escolha Excluir bucket.

  6. No prompt exibido, confirme se o bucket atende a qualquer uma das seguintes condições:

    • Contém um objeto

    • Tem chaves de acesso

    • Está anexado a uma instância

    • É a origem de uma distribuição

    Se ele tiver qualquer uma dessas condições, você deve optar por forçar a exclusão do bucket.

  7. Escolha uma das seguintes opções:

    • Escolha Forçar exclusão para excluir seu bucket mesmo que ele tenha qualquer uma das condições listadas na etapa 6 deste procedimento.

    • Escolha Sim, excluir para excluir seu bucket se ele não tiver nenhuma das condições listadas na etapa 6 deste procedimento.

    • Escolha Não, cancelar para cancelar a exclusão.

Exclua seu bucket usando o AWS CLI

Conclua o procedimento a seguir para excluir seu bucket usando o AWS Command Line Interface (AWS CLI). Faça isso usando o comando delete-bucket. Para obter mais informações, consulte delete-bucket na AWS CLI Command Reference.

nota

Você deve instalar AWS CLI e configurá-lo para o Lightsail e o Amazon S3 antes de continuar com esse procedimento. Para obter mais informações, consulte Configurar o AWS CLI para trabalhar com o Lightsail.

  1. Abra um prompt de comando ou uma janela de terminal.

  2. No prompt de comando ou na janela do terminal, digite um dos seguintes comandos:

    • Digite o comando a seguir para excluir um bucket que não tenha as condições listadas na seção Forçar exclusão de um bucket deste guia.

      aws lightsail delete-bucket --bucket-name BucketName
    • Digite o comando a seguir para forçar a exclusão de um bucket que tenha as condições listadas na seção Forçar exclusão de um bucket deste guia.

      aws lightsail delete-bucket --bucket-name BucketName --force-delete

    Nos comandos, BucketNamesubstitua pelo nome do bucket que você deseja excluir.

    Exemplo:

    aws lightsail delete-bucket --bucket-name DOC-EXAMPLE-BUCKET

    Você deverá ver um resultado semelhante ao seguinte exemplo:

    Resultado da solicitação de exclusão do bucket

Gerenciar buckets e objetos

Estas são as etapas gerais para gerenciar seu bucket de armazenamento de objetos do Lightsail:

  1. Saiba mais sobre objetos e buckets no serviço de armazenamento de objetos Amazon Lightsail. Para obter mais informações, consulte Armazenamento de objetos no Amazon Lightsail.

  2. Saiba mais sobre os nomes que você pode dar aos seus buckets no Amazon Lightsail. Para obter mais informações, consulte Regras de nomenclatura de buckets no Amazon Lightsail.

  3. Comece a usar o serviço de armazenamento de objetos Lightsail criando um bucket. Para obter mais informações, consulte Criação de buckets no Amazon Lightsail.

  4. Saiba mais sobre as práticas recomendadas de segurança para buckets e as permissões de acesso que você pode configurar para o bucket. Você pode tornar todos os objetos em seu bucket públicos ou privados, ou tem a opção de tornar públicos objetos individuais. Também é possível conceder acesso ao bucket criando chaves de acesso, anexando instâncias ao bucket e concedendo acesso a outras contas da AWS. Para obter mais informações, consulte Melhores práticas de segurança para armazenamento de objetos do Amazon Lightsail e Entendendo as permissões de bucket no Amazon Lightsail.

    Depois de aprender sobre as permissões de acesso ao bucket, consulte os seguintes guias para conceder acesso ao bucket:

  5. Saiba como habilitar o registro em log de acesso ao bucket e como usar logs de acesso para auditar a segurança do bucket. Para obter mais informações, consulte os guias a seguir.

  6. Crie uma política do IAM que conceda ao usuário a capacidade de gerenciar um bucket no Lightsail. Para obter mais informações, consulte a política do IAM para gerenciar buckets no Amazon Lightsail.

  7. Saiba mais sobre a forma como os objetos do bucket são rotulados e identificados. Para obter mais informações, consulte Entendendo nomes de chaves de objetos no Amazon Lightsail.

  8. Saiba como carregar arquivos e gerenciar objetos nos buckets. Para obter mais informações, consulte os guias a seguir.

  9. Habilite o versionamento de objeto para preservar, recuperar e restaurar todas as versões de cada objeto armazenado no bucket. Para obter mais informações, consulte Habilitar e suspender o controle de versão de objetos em um bucket no Amazon Lightsail.

  10. Depois de ativar o controle de versionamento de objetos, você pode restaurar versões anteriores de objetos do bucket. Para obter mais informações, consulte Restauração de versões anteriores de objetos em um bucket no Amazon Lightsail.

  11. Monitore a utilização do seu bucket. Para obter mais informações, consulte Visualização de métricas para seu bucket no Amazon Lightsail.

  12. Configure um alarme para que as métricas do bucket sejam notificadas quando a utilização do bucket ultrapassar um limite. Para obter mais informações, consulte Criação de alarmes métricos de bucket no Amazon Lightsail.

  13. Altere o plano de armazenamento do bucket se ele estiver com pouco armazenamento e transferência de rede. Para obter mais informações, consulte Alteração do plano do seu bucket no Amazon Lightsail.

  14. Saiba como conectar o bucket a outros recursos. Para obter mais informações, consulte os tutoriais a seguir.

  15. Exclua seu bucket se não o estiver mais usando. Para obter mais informações, consulte Excluir buckets no Amazon Lightsail.